MA S2177 | 2021-2022 | 192nd General Court

Note: Legislation replaced by S2715

Status

Spectrum: Partisan Bill (Democrat 3-0)
Status: Introduced on March 29 2021 - 25% progression, died in chamber
Action: 2022-02-24 - Accompanied a study order, see S2715
Text: Latest bill text (Introduced) [PDF]

Summary

For legislation relative to natural gas shut-off valves, gate boxes and public safety. Telecommunications, Utilities and Energy.
